Context: The Korean Casino
Korea's stock market is a concentrated bet on two semiconductor giants. When AI hype inflated their valuations, the rest of the index became a shadow. The circuit breaker was designed for a diversified crash, not a single-sector collapse. On July 29, the trigger levels were hit within minutes. Instead of calming nerves, the halts created a vacuum. Traders knew the pause would end, so they positioned for the gap-down. The result was a self-fulfilling liquidation.
Crypto markets face the same structural risk. Look at any centralized exchange's circuit breaker — it halts trading when a coin drops 20% in an hour. In theory, it gives the market time to absorb news. In practice, it signals panic. Bots detect the halt, compute the likely reopen price, and flood the order book with limit sells. When trading resumes, the drop is sharper than if the breaker never existed. I saw this during DeFi Summer 2020, when Compound's liquidation cascades were caused not by high leverage alone but by the staggered halt in oracle updates. The pause became the trigger.
Core: The Systematic Teardown
Let me dissect the failure mechanism mathematically. The Korean circuit breaker uses three thresholds: 8%, 15%, and 20% drops in the KOSPI. At each level, trading stops for 20 minutes, then resumes with a single-price auction. The problem is that the auction price is determined by the imbalance between buy and sell orders. In a panic, sell orders overwhelm buy orders, so the auction price gaps down. Traders who missed the first drop now face an even worse entry point, triggering further panic.
In crypto, the same logic applies. Consider the March 2020 crash on BitMEX: the XBTUSD perpetual contract's 5% circuit breaker (called a "liquidation engine slowdown") actually aggregated liquidations into a single large event. Instead of smoothing volatility, it created a cliff. The pause allowed whales to cancel their buy walls and reposition lower. Retail was left holding the bag.
But the deeper issue is concentration. Korea's circuit breaker is rendered pointless because two stocks drive the index. If Samsung and SK Hynix crash, the rest of the market is dragged down regardless of fundamentals. Crypto has its own version: BTC dominance. When Bitcoin drops 10%, altcoins fall 20-30% even if their fundamentals are sound. The circuit breaker on a BTC/USDT pair doesn't protect the broader ecosystem; it just isolates the collapse to one liquidity pool.
The hidden information: The Korean Financial Services Commission admitted after the crash that the circuit breaker was never stress-tested for a scenario where the top two components drop simultaneously. The same is true for most crypto protocols. Every DEX I've audited has a circuit breaker—usually a pause on the entire market—but no one has modeled what happens when Chainlink's price feed pauses for 10 minutes while the underlying asset continues to trade on CEXs. That happened in March 2023 with multiple oracles, and it caused cascading liquidations across Aave v3.
Contrarian: What the Bulls Got Right
To be fair, the circuit breaker works in normal conditions. When a single stock (like Tesla) hits a circuit breaker due to a news event, the pause does allow retail investors to reassess. The Korean market's problem is exponential weighting, not the mechanism itself. Crypto bulls point to this: they argue that circuit breakers are necessary for retail protection, and that the real failure is in market structure, not the rule.
There's truth here. I've seen cases where a well-designed circuit breaker saved a DEX from a flash loan attack. For example, the Uniswap v3 TWAP oracle can act as a natural circuit breaker by preventing oracle manipulation for large blocks. The trick is making the pause conditional on volatility relative to a broader index, not absolute price movement. Korea could fix its system by using a volatility-weighted circuit breaker that only triggers when the drop is unusual relative to the VKOSPI (implied volatility index). Some crypto protocols already do this—like dYdX's insurance fund activating when leverage exceeds a rolling threshold.
But here's the contrarian insight: the bulls are right that circuit breakers can work, but they ignore the second-order effect. Once a circuit breaker becomes expected, traders front-run it. The mechanism itself becomes a tool for manipulation. I've traced wallet behavior during multiple CEX halts: the same addresses that accumulate before the pause dump into the auction.
